Failed to load SDCZip.dll

When I download packages and try to install them I receive the follow message:

"Error: Failed to load SDCZip.dll. Please reinstall the application to correct this problem".

Since I don't run SDC (Stardock Central Services), I found the answer in a batch file that was posted somewhere.

I manually opened (regedit) my registry and went to this key:
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Stardock\ObjectDesktop

and added a New "string value" by right-clicking with a name of SDCzip.
Then I added a path ... C:\Program Files\Common Files\Stardock\SDCzip.dll to this key.

I get my download links via e-mail, and install the stand-alone programs of Stardock. Apparently they miss setting some small but important links occasionally. It seems SDC gets the full(er) treatment on installs.

Thanks this save me a lot time. The only thing for me that I'm not an expert on the modification of the registry gave me a little confusion on how to add a path in the registry. So I will add to your instructions "Then I added a path by right clicking the SDCzip and on the modify I added the path... C:\Program Files\Common Files\Stardock\SDCzip.dll to this key.
